radv: dump GPU hang report logs into $HOME/radv_dumps_<pid>
This creates a directory and save various logs (dmesg, umr, pipeline, gpu info, etc) instead of printing stuff to stdout/stderr. This dumps the following files when a GPU hang is detected: - dmesg.log - gpu_info.lo - options.log - pipeline.log (shaders including SPIR-V if spirv-dis found) - registers.log - trace.log - vm_fault (if a VM fault is detected) - umr_ring.log (if UMR found) - umr_waves.log (if UMR found) Signed-off-by: Samuel Pitoiset <samuel.pitoiset@gmail.com> Reviewed-by: Bas Nieuwenhuizen <bas@basnieuwenhuizen.nl> Part-of: <https://gitlab.freedesktop.org/mesa/mesa/-/merge_requests/7233>
